some Guard Scorpion experimentation

- Phase 2 can be ended early by using fire on the core. the core's immune to lightning, but the bot isn't.
- Barrets focused shot consumes ALL his ATB, but a two-bar shot deals around 60% stagger. so he and Cloud can force a quick stagger to skip Phase 3.
- In the final phase, taking down a leg immediately brings the boss to around 80% stagger. So use Punisher and Overcharge to quickly whittle it down, and then use your ATB on stagger phase to get the quick kill.
- Use your limit breaks at the END of Stagger Phase. As it automatically brings it to an end, as does pushing a phase.
- Switch between your characters. They gather ATB so slowly AI controlled, you need to be swapping between Cloud and Barret to get their ATB up and then coordinate their attacks to drive the Stagger gauge to full.

You can kill Guard Scorpion in around 2-4 minutes by using his weaknesses and learning your abilities.

This is the sign by the way of a good action game. Because your first fight with Guard Scorpion, Oh it takes so long to kill him, but if you learn your abilities and how they work on the boss, you can utterly crush it.

Zushio posted:

The Trails games all do save import between chapter of individual sub-series. Sky 1 > 2 > 3 you got bonus items depending on your rating and your level carried over if it was within a certain range. If you were under the range you get bumped up in the next game, and if you were over you get cut down a little. You could also start each game fresh with the characters already at the appropriate level and no bonus items.

The Crossbell sub-series and Cold Steel sub-series do roughly the same, except for Cold Steel 3 since it was an entirely different console generation than Cold Steel 2 (this will likely be a non-issue going from PS4 to PS5, but PS3 to PS4 saves were not compatible AFAIK). It worked really well in all the games and gave good incentive to get a high ranking (sidequests and events). The games themselves are SNES/PS1 style RPGs, easily my favourite RPG series other than Yakuza. They do have a tonne of SNES/PS1 style hidden sidequests and events though, so unless you want to play a dozen times a guide is recommended.
